The chairman of Balochistan National Movement (BNM), Khalil Baloch, has said in a statement that his party will launch an online campaign against the ‘illegal’ extradition of Rashid Hussain to Pakistan on 22 June.

According to the details, the BNM has announced an online campaign against the abduction of the Rashid Hussain, an exiled Baloch political and human rights activist from UAE and his subsequent extradition to Pakistan on 22 June. He said that Mr Hussain and his family have made sacrifices in the Baloch struggle and, therefore, we should vocalize for them.

Khalil Baloch said that the UAE authorities unlawfully detained Rashid Hussain and then violated the international code of conduct by extraditing him to Pakistan on 22 June 2019.

He said that Pakistan has obstructed the nationalist political and human rights activists from carrying out a peaceful struggle. He said that the incessant operations, kill-and-dumps and mass murders have compelled the Baloch activists to adopt a self-imposed exile.

Mr Baloch said that the extradition of Rashid Hussain was broadcasted as ‘breaking news’ by the Pakistani media. He said that the media had claimed that the accused of the China consulate attack has been detained in UAE and then repatriated to Pakistan. He further said the ‘state-run’ media broadcasted this fabricated news on Pakistan’s behest.

Rashid Hussain was a human rights activist living in UAE in self-exile. In December 2018, he was allegedly detained by the UAE special agencies, kept in confinement for six months and the extradited to Pakistan June 22, 2019. Since his repatriation, the Pakistani government has not conducted any legal trial for his case. His whereabouts and condition remain unknown to this day.
